Performance
The performance gap between these devices is substantial. The Poco X6 Pro’s MediaTek Dimensity 8300 Ultra (4nm) is a powerhouse, featuring a 1x3.35 GHz Cortex-A715 core and three additional Cortex-A715 cores, alongside four Cortex-A510 cores. This contrasts sharply with the Galaxy F15’s Dimensity 6100+ (6nm), which uses older Cortex-A76 and A55 cores. The 4nm process of the X6 Pro’s chip also offers better power efficiency, reducing thermal throttling during sustained workloads. This means the X6 Pro will handle demanding games and applications with greater ease and consistency.
